Why warm light still wins

Warm light has remaining power because it enhances the products most homes are constructed from. Block reviews richer under warmer tones. Natural wood, stone, painted trim, copper rain gutters, and even dark exterior siding all have a tendency to look more refined when brightened with a soft amber-white instead of a stark blue-white.

In functional terms, many homeowners that desire a timeless look gravitate toward color temperature levels in the area of 2200K to 3000K. There is no magic number that suits every residence, yet that range typically avoids the sterile cast that can make a residence seem like a parking area canopy. If the home has standard design, older stonework, or warm-toned exterior coatings, approaching the lower end of that range frequently produces a gentler, more lovely effect.

What classic sophistication really resembles on a house

Timeless lighting is rarely uniform in a simple way. It is balanced. It values the architecture as opposed to tracing every line with the very same aesthetic weight.

For instance, a long ranch home with a low roofline benefits from refined continuity and a mild wash of warm light that maintains the structure from disappearing right into the landscape. A high colonial or craftsman can deal with much more vertical focus, especially around entrance features, dormers, or a main gable. A contemporary farmhouse usually looks ideal when the lighting sustains the symmetry without over-illuminating the garage.

The common thread is proportion. If every eave is equally intense, the eye has no place to remainder. If the front entrance is underlit while second lines blaze away, your house loses power structure. Excellent irreversible illumination produces order after dark. It assists a visitor comprehend where to look first, where to walk, and what makes the design special.

The information that divide beauty from excess

An ageless installment typically depends on a handful of layout decisions working together:

  1. Conceal the fixtures so the light is seen greater than the equipment
  2. Choose cozy white as the default scene, with dimming readily available
  3. Match illumination to the home's range rather than maxing out output
  4. Emphasize significant architectural lines, not every possible edge
  5. Keep spacing constant, especially on very noticeable front elevations

None of these factors are complicated on paper. In practice, however, each calls for judgment. Two-inch changes in obstacle can modify glare. Component spacing that looks even from a ladder might review uneven from the road. A setup that really feels stylish at 8:00 p.m. May be too bright by 11:00 p.m. When the area has gone quiet.

That is why mockups matter. On better tasks, installers test a little section at dusk rather than making presumptions in full daylight.

The makeup of a good Irreversible LED Illumination Installation

Homeowners typically concentrate on the visible outcome, yet the undetectable decisions figure out whether the system will mature well. Mounting method, cable television directing, controller place, weatherproofing, solution gain access to, and power planning all issue just as much as the light output.

A clean installation normally begins with placement under soffits, fascia lips, or trim information that shield the diode from straight sight. This is not just about appearance. Protected positioning softens the result and minimizes determines of glare when someone comes close to from the driveway or sidewalk. If the components are too exposed, even warm soft lights can really feel sharp.

Wire monitoring is another place where craftsmanship programs. On a well-finished home, sloppy cabling stands apart promptly in daylight. The most effective installers path inconspicuously, color-match where appropriate, and avoid developing upkeep headaches by hiding critical connections where they can not be gotten to later.

Power and control systems are worthy of equal focus. A huge home may require zoning to ensure that lengthy rooflines, entry areas, garage wings, and landscape-adjacent areas can be handled intelligently. This is not just helpful for custom scenes. It also helps with troubleshooting and keeps voltage performance a lot more stable throughout the system.

Weather direct exposure adds one more layer. South-facing elevations, coastal air, hefty snow areas, and high-heat attic-adjacent soffits each put different tension on products. A product that executes well in one atmosphere might require additional treatment or a various mounting approach in another. That is one factor covering suggestions online tends to disappoint. Climate always obtains a vote.

Warm light and LED modern technology are no longer at odds

Years ago, some irreversible systems had a hard time to simulate the inviting high quality of standard incandescent vacation lights. The outcome might really feel also crisp or also digital, particularly when seen directly. That gap has narrowed substantially. Better diode quality, more powerful diffuser layout, and much more nuanced controllers have actually made it feasible to attain a softer visual outcome, specifically when cozy white channels are adjusted properly.

Still, not every LED system creates the very same type of warmth. Some "cozy white" presets lean peach, others drift green at reduced dim levels, and some lose their style when watched from a range because the spacing or lensing creates a dotted result as opposed to a continual radiance. This is one location where seeing actual mounted examples aids more than reviewing specifications.

I normally urge property owners to ask what the system resembles from 3 placements: directly under the eave, nearby, and from an angle as they draw into the driveway. A lighting setup can perform magnificently from one of those viewpoints and let down from another. The goal is uniformity in lived experience, not simply a good photograph.

What homeowners need to ask prior to hiring an installer

The top quality void in this sector is genuine. Products differ, however workmanship differs much more. A home owner does not require to come to be an illumination engineer, though a few useful questions can expose whether an installer is believing beyond a quick sale.

  1. Where will the components rest, and will certainly they show up from the road in daytime
  2. What cozy white range does the system produce, and can it be dimmed quickly
  3. How are cords, ports, and power products secured and accessed for solution
  4. Can the installer show regional examples of homes using downplayed day-to-day setups
  5. What is covered if a section fails, discolors, or behaves inconsistently over time

The answers issue. So does the self-confidence behind them. Experienced installers typically explain trade-offs without overselling perfection. They know older soffits may require extra treatment. They understand steep optimals or blended materials can make complex symmetry. They understand that app convenience does not compensate for poor physical layout.

A trustworthy specialist also speaks about what not to light. That is frequently the clearest sign they care about the last appearance.

Common mistakes that age an illumination project quickly

The first error is picking awesome white due to the fact that it seems brighter during a trial. It typically is brighter, at least perceptually. It is also more likely to feel outdated or commercial gradually on a residence.

The secondly is over-lighting. Numerous homes require much less strength than their owners anticipate. When the eye can see each point resource plainly from the curb, the design normally needs either much more concealment, more dimming, or both.

The third is ignoring daytime appearance. Permanent systems survive on the home 365 days a year. If the track, lens, or wire is visually intrusive in sunlight, the task compromises the façade even when the lights are off.

The fourth is going after pattern scenes at the cost of an elegant default. If the application has plenty of impacts yet the cozy white setting looks weak, harsh, or irregular, the system will certainly not provide the classic sophistication most owners in fact want.

Finally, poor maintenance planning overtakes individuals. Every permanent system eventually requires some service. Parts age. Storms take place. Firmware adjustments. If accessibility is impossible or paperwork is missing, little issues come to be expensive ones.
